Ticket PR-2241: The Marrowfield payroll export switched from CSV to the new ledger format, but staging still points at the old Copperline endpoint. Per security review, the misconfigured `.env` on the export runner must be corrected before Friday's run. Update `PAYEX_FORMAT=ledger_v2`, then set the signing credential on the following line.

env line for fafof-fahag: LEDGER_TOKEN5=f8790

Hi Brightcart integrations team,

We've finished staging the Cascadia restock planner endpoints for your vending fleet pilot. Forecast pulls run hourly; restock suggestions post back within five minutes. If a sync stalls, the on-call engineer should replay the last job via the admin route rather than resetting the queue. Replay requests must include the bearer token below.

session JWT of yawep-yawep = eyJhbGciOiJIUzI1NiIsInR5cCI6IkpXVCJ9.eyJzdWIiOiI3pWF3_In0.aXYsHiog

Hey Priyala — handing off the Tollgate billing worker before I rotate onto Lanternfish. Blue-green deploys are live now: green pool drains invoices, blue picks up new charge events, and the switchover waits for the ledger flush. Plugin authors targeting the worker hooks should test against the green slot first, since blue rejects unversioned payloads. Swapping takes about ninety seconds end to end. The values the worker boots with in both slots are as follows.

settings of tagef-bawif:
DRUIX_HOST=druix.zemvarlabs.internal
DRUIX_PORT=8000

**Q: The graph in GraphLoom shows a cycle my review didn't catch — is the tool wrong?**

Usually not. GraphLoom resolves transitive imports, so cycles may span modules that look independent in the diff. Click the highlighted edge to see the exact import chain and file lines involved. False positives do occur with generated code; check whether any node is marked autogenerated. If you believe the cycle is spurious, report it with the graph export attached.

escalation mailbox, bafog-fafog: ulador@paliqlabs.internal